The Singleton Lions Club members will be making sure that’s the case at the Civic Centre’s Australia Day celebrations on Monday by cooking up a storm come breakfast time.
The Lions have shared the honour of cooking up “brekkie” for the past 12 years with the Rotary Club – and are gearing up for big crowd.
If they aren’t assisting with the catering, they’re helping by making the tough decisions on the Australia Day Committee.
For only $5 this year you can have bacon, eggs, two chipolatas, a muffin, tea, coffee and juice.
This Australia Day and the week prior the Lions Driver Reviver will also make sure that people on the road can have that respite they need.
Full program - Civic Centre and Civic Green
8.00am Lions Breakfast BBQ Commences
8.30am Town Band commences
9.30am Official Australia Day Ceremony commences
10.00am Food services, market stalls, emergency vehicle display, Aqua balls,Jumping Castle, Aqua Slide - open
10.00am FREE Arts and Crafts marquee open & Singleton Mobile Preschool
10.00am FREE Face Painting begins
10.00am Stiltwalkers begin
10.30am Hunter Valley Zoo Koalas, reptiles and farm animals
11.00am Official Australia Day Ceremony Concludes
11.00am Lance Friend commences
11.00am Lioness Morning Tea in Foyer commences
11.00am Lions Breakfast BBQ Concludes
11.00am Rotary Lunch BBQ Commences
11.30am Tug-o-War competition
12pm Annual Tug 'o War Trophy presentation
12.15pm Thong throwing competition
1.30pm Lance Friend concludes and Event closes
